First, the town’s geography matters. Santa Marinella sits on the coast just west of Rome, offering a quieter environment than central Rome while still providing easy rail and road connections. The daily rhythm here tends toward a calm, efficient pace—perfect for focused work sessions in the morning followed by a refreshing walk along the promenade or a late afternoon swim. Practical tips for securing fast wifi and a productive workspace
To maximize the remote-work potential of your Santa Marinella stay, consider these practical steps when booking vacation rentals, holiday rentals, or a hotel room with business-friendly features:
- Ask for the exact wifi configuration: speed (if possible in Mbps), upload/download consistency, and whether there is a wired Ethernet option in the workspace.
- Request a quiet work area: confirm that the desk is away from common living spaces, has noise-reducing features, and offers a comfortable chair suitable for long sessions.
- Check power accessibility: ensure there are multiple reliable outlets near the workspace for laptops, chargers, and peripherals, plus a reliable backup power plan if the local infrastructure fluctuates.
- Confirm workspace flexibility: verify that the desk height is comfortable, there is sufficient lighting, and the layout allows for dual-monitor setups if needed.
- Inquire about business amenities: look for hosts or hotels that provide coffee stations, a business lounge, or a small meeting room that can be booked for client calls or virtual meetings.
- Consider a backup plan: identify nearby cafes with reliable wifi or coworking spaces in the vicinity as a contingency for days when a personal workspace isn’t ideal.
- Prepare for the Lazio environment: ensure you have travel-friendly SIM cards or eSIM options, coverage from local providers, and a plan for roaming or data usage during trips to Rome or other towns.
